How to Reply Naturally

The best response usually depends on who is asking and your relationship with them.

Keep It Professional at Work

Coworkers and professional contacts usually appreciate balanced responses.

Example:
“Work has been demanding but rewarding honestly.”

Professional communication experts from Harvard Business Review often explain that positive workplace communication improves collaboration and emotional trust.

Be Honest With Close People

Friends, family, and partners usually appreciate emotional honesty more.

Example:
“Honestly, work has been mentally draining lately.”

Open communication honestly strengthens emotional connection.

Use Humor to Keep Things Light

Funny responses honestly make stressful conversations feel easier.

Example:
“My inbox honestly is trying to destroy me.”

Humor can reduce stress and improve social connection naturally.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Giving Dry One-Word Replies

Replies like “fine” honestly kill conversations quickly.

Complaining Constantly

Being honest is good, but nonstop negativity can feel emotionally heavy.

Pretending Everything Is Perfect

Authenticity honestly creates stronger connection.

Forgetting to Ask Back

Balanced conversations feel more natural.

Example:
“Work is going okay honestly, how about yours?”
